Mount Airy, Nc vs Marcos Juarez Climate & Distance Between

Argentina flag
  • The distance between Mount Airy, Nc, Usa and Marcos Juarez, Argentina is approximately 7,994 km or 4,967 mi.
  • To reach Mount Airy, Nc in this distance one would set out from Marcos Juarez bearing 344.2°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Mount Airy, Nc bearing 343.4° or NNW .
  • Both have a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• Mount Airy, Nc is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Marcos Juarez is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 4 °C (7.2°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 7.8 °C (14°F) more in Mount Airy, Nc.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 258.4 mm (10.2 in) more which is equivalent to 258.4 l/m² (6.34 US gal/ft²) or 2,584,000 l/ha (276,247 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.6° lower in Mount Airy, Nc than in Marcos Juarez.
